United Bancorporation of Alabama, Inc. reported earnings results for the third quarter and nine months ended September 30, 2023. For the third quarter, the company reported net interest income was USD 14.99 million compared to USD 11.67 million a year ago. Net income was USD 7.15 million compared to USD 5.67 million a year ago. Basic earnings per share from continuing operations was USD 1.99 compared to USD 1.58 a year ago. Diluted earnings per share from continuing operations was USD 1.99 compared to USD 1.58 a year ago.
For the nine months, net interest income was USD 43.43 million compared to USD 29.86 million a year ago. Net income was USD 21.15 million compared to USD 13.53 million a year ago. Basic earnings per share from continuing operations was USD 5.88 compared to USD 3.68 a year ago. Diluted earnings per share from continuing operations was USD 5.88 compared to USD 3.68 a year ago.
United Bancorporation of Alabama, Inc. is a financial holding company that primarily serves Southwest Alabama as well as Northwest Florida. The Company is a Community Development Financial Institution (CDFI) that operates three subsidiaries: United Bank, Town-Country United Bank and UB Community Development. United Bank is also designated as a CDFI and operates 22 locations across five counties. Town-Country United Bank serves Wilcox County and its surrounding counties. UB Community Development focuses on economic and community development through its New Market Tax Credits, affordable housing and community facilities programs. United Bank has offices in Atmore, Brewton, East Brewton, Flomaton, Monroeville, Frisco City, Bay Minette, Daphne, Foley, Lillian, Loxley, Magnolia Springs, Semmes, Silverhill and Summerdale in Alabama. United Bank serves Santa Rosa County, Florida in Jay, Milton and Pace.
